aboutsummaryrefslogtreecommitdiffstats
path: root/src/libs/utils/terminalinterface.cpp
diff options
context:
space:
mode:
authorhjk <[email protected]>2025-04-11 11:51:03 +0200
committerhjk <[email protected]>2025-04-11 14:51:57 +0000
commiteeaa93fc749d36abb7b2f175ba25d36cbd95d1c6 (patch)
tree2fe3132c1431f3a365191e844db9031d950d3880 /src/libs/utils/terminalinterface.cpp
parenta460ec1641f6fb39901bb38d930a209a9078efaf (diff)
Replace most expected_str by Utils::Result
Keep it in Axivion dto, which is generated. Change-Id: I83a12de6234ac7b0218b369875bdc72d25dbadfb Reviewed-by: Eike Ziller <[email protected]> Reviewed-by: Jarek Kobus <[email protected]>
Diffstat (limited to 'src/libs/utils/terminalinterface.cpp')
-rw-r--r--src/libs/utils/terminalinterface.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/libs/utils/terminalinterface.cpp b/src/libs/utils/terminalinterface.cpp
index 6f7bb11f81e..33e359d8c83 100644
--- a/src/libs/utils/terminalinterface.cpp
+++ b/src/libs/utils/terminalinterface.cpp
@@ -199,7 +199,7 @@ void TerminalInterface::onStubReadyRead()
}
}
-expected_str<void> TerminalInterface::startStubServer()
+Result<> TerminalInterface::startStubServer()
{
if (HostOsInfo::isWindowsHost()) {
if (d->stubServer.listen(QString::fromLatin1("creator-%1-%2")
@@ -310,7 +310,7 @@ void TerminalInterface::start()
return;
if (m_setup.m_terminalMode == TerminalMode::Detached) {
- expected_str<qint64> result;
+ Result<qint64> result;
QMetaObject::invokeMethod(
d->stubCreator,
[this, &result] { result = d->stubCreator->startStubProcess(m_setup); },
@@ -326,7 +326,7 @@ void TerminalInterface::start()
return;
}
- const expected_str<void> result = startStubServer();
+ const Result<> result = startStubServer();
if (!result) {
emitError(QProcess::FailedToStart, msgCommChannelFailed(result.error()));
return;